How have immigrant culinary traditions of New York City influenced the food served in its finest restaurants? Chef Daniel Humm and General Manager Will Guidara of acclaimed restaurant Eleven Madison Park will discuss how they’ve melded Jewish, Italian, Irish, and other traditions during New York City’s mass immigrations into contemporary fine-dining cuisine. Humm and Guidara will be joined in conversation with Mitchell Davis, Executive Vice President of the James Beard Foundation.
Tastings from Eleven Madison Park included.
